Abstract


In this work, we studied the Spanish press coverage (El País, El Mundo, ABC, La Vanguardia y La Voz de Galicia) with Fourth Centenary’s activities of publication of first half of El ingenioso hidalgo Don Quijote de la Mancha, by Miguel de Cervantes, centenary celebrated in 2005. We analyzed all the kinds of information (news, reports, interviews and opinion articles) in order to find if there was an intellectual debate in these newspapers. Furthermore, we will study if the famous knight-errant was a commercial element and if his centenary caused political tension.
